About This Home

The Fluhr-Barth is one of the more architecturally distinctive Baufritz designs, with angular facade features, mixed materials, and a geometric clarity that gives it a stronger visual identity than most of the range. The two-level layout across 271 m² is open-plan with good light throughout, and the design takes its form seriously rather than applying surface detail to a conventional box.

Ecological timber frame construction applies, with Baufritz's wood shaving insulation, large energy-efficient windows, and smart energy management. High-end finishes are available, and the interior layout can be customised to the buyer's specification. The company provides full planning support and the build meets German engineering standards.

For buyers who want an ecological Baufritz home that makes a design statement without stepping outside the company's technical comfort zone, the Fluhr-Barth is one of the most credible options.
